Transaction 862a2b56ddb00156fa53ea0545db8ef698274b5d47136053f6039481729c2057
1 Input
2 Outputs
- 862a2b56ddb00156fa53ea0545db8ef698274b5d47136053f6039481729c2057:0
- 862a2b56ddb00156fa53ea0545db8ef698274b5d47136053f6039481729c2057:1
value 1263943767
address 3PNDFUF1pJJnkEiJBRnvvaFWWVr9SJHgra
value 919858
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w